Abstract
The present paper deals with the correspondence of Count Johann Mailáth, a supranational go-between in the first half of the 19th century. The essay is a stocktaking of Mailáth's letters, they are collected in the Austrian National Library and the Vienna City Library. The author of the article would like to show that 1) Count Mailáth can be seen as a multiple “Grenzgänger” between communication spaces, languages and genres and 2) that the analysis of his multilingual and multiethnic network can determine several turning points in his writing career. The aim of the contribution is to supplement the previously known biography of the author and to define epochal boundaries in his oeuvre.

Hungarian Studies intends to fill a long-felt need in the coverage of Hungarian studies by offering an independent, international forum for original papers of high scholarly standards within all disciplines of the humanities and social sciences (literature, philology, ethnology, folklore, musicology, art history, philosophy, history, sociology, etc.) pertaining to any aspects of the Hungarian past or present. In addition, every issue will carry short communications, book reviews and miscellaneous information - all features of interest to the widening audience of Hungarian studies.
